☐ **Sort the newbie's site access (Day 1)**

While Maplewright House is being renovated, we're all camped out at the Dunmore Annex on Carter Lane. Walk the new starter over before 09:30 so they can get their photo taken for a temp badge. Until that badge is printed (usually by lunch), they'll need to get through the annex side door, which takes the code below.

staff pass of kagup-fajog = bdg-QCHVQW-99665837

- [ ] **Step 7: Breaker override escrow.** After sealing the signing keys for the Tallgrove upstream API circuit breaker, confirm the support team can force the breaker open during a full outage. The override bundle lives in the sealed escrow drawer and is useless without its unlock phrase. Two ceremony witnesses must initial this step before proceeding. The escrow bundle is decrypted with the recovery passphrase that follows.

vault phrase of kahip-kahop = holath-quenmir

Subject: Gridsmith cut-over done

Hi — the crossword generator is fully cut over to the new puzzle pipeline as of this afternoon. Old clue-bank jobs are drained and the legacy solver is off. If anything weird shows up overnight (stuck grids, duplicate clues), restart the composer worker first. For reference, the generator is now running with these settings.

settings of tagef-bawif:
DRUIX_HOST=druix.zemvarlabs.internal
DRUIX_PORT=8000